AFTON – A retired elementary school teacher’s aide has been found dead, the victim of an apparent homicide, Nelson County Sheriff David Brooks said this morning.

And the driver behind the wheel of her dark-green 1998 Chevrolet Malibu may have a 15-hour head start.

Brooks identified the victim as Opal Page, 73, of the 7200 block of Rockfish Valley Highway. Authorities are investigating the death as a homicide because of forced entry into her home and the missing car, Brooks said.

Nelson County Capt. Ron Robertson said authorities got a call from a neighbor last evening after Page missed a lunch date. Authorities arrived to find her in a pool of blood.

“I took one look,“ Robertson said, and “told my guys to get out, this is beyond us.“

The missing car, with license plate No. YZR1900, was last seen traveling northbound on Va. 151 at 6 a.m. yesterday, Robertson said. One of two back doors to the home had been broken in, he said.

Page had been a longtime teacher’s aide at Rockfish River Elementary School, where she continued to volunteer after retiring five years ago, said Principal Nita Hughes.

“She was just one of the most kind, gentle caring people you’d ever meet,“ Hughes said.

Page’s modest white, one-story house stands across from another home along an isolated stretch of highway. A large Virginia State Police crime scene investigation truck is parked outside and a strip of crime scene tape blocks entry into the home.

Virginia State Police forensics officers are assisting the sheriff’s department in the investigation. Page’s body has been sent to a state medical examiner’s office in Richmond for an autopsy.
